Sunday 10th April 2005
Jeff Gordon came back from being three laps down and held off Kasey Kahne at the finish to win the Advance Auto Parts 500 at Martinsville Speedway. Gordon became the first repeat winner of 2005, also winning the Daytona 500. It was his 71st (of 93) career series win and sixth (of nine) at Martinsville. Gordon fell behind after making an unscheduled pit stop for a loose front wheel on Lap 46. On Lap 279, Gordon was able to rejoin the lead lap when he received the free pass after Elliott Sadler spun Sterling Marlin.
